WebClarke's Commentary. Verse Matthew 6:33. But seek ye first the kingdom of God — Matthew 3:7.. His righteousness — That holiness of heart and purity of life which God requires of those who profess to be subjects of that spiritual kingdom mentioned above. Matthew 5:20..
